1. Read the Recipe Thoroughly
Before you even preheat your oven, make sure to read the entire recipe. This will help you understand the steps involved and the time you need to allocate for your baking project.
2. Measure Ingredients Accurately
Proper measurements are crucial in baking. Here’s how to measure different ingredients accurately:
- Flour: Spoon into the measuring cup and level off with a knife.
- Brown Sugar: Pack it firmly into the cup before leveling.
- Baking Powder/Baking Soda: Scoop and level for precision.
3. Use Room Temperature Ingredients
Most baking recipes call for butter, eggs, and other ingredients at room temperature, as it helps them blend more smoothly and evenly. If you forget to take them out in advance, quick tips include:
- Warm cold eggs in a bowl of warm water for about 10 minutes.
- Soften butter in the microwave for 5-10 seconds, but don’t melt it!
4. Sift Dry Ingredients
Sifting flour, cocoa powder, or powdered sugar not only removes lumps but also adds air to these ingredients, making your cakes and cookies lighter and fluffier.
5. Don’t Skip the Oven Preheating
Preheating your oven to the recommended temperature ensures that your baked goods rise properly and achieve the desired texture. Always give your oven at least 15-20 minutes to preheat!
6. Invest in Quality Bakeware
Your choice of bakeware can influence the outcome of your baked goods. For best results, opt for:
- Heavy-duty metal pans for even heat distribution.
- Non-stick pans that ease the release of treats.
- Glass pans, which allow you to monitor browning easily.
7. Rotate Your Trays
Most ovens have hot spots. To ensure even baking, rotate your trays halfway through the baking time. This can help your treats bake uniformly without overcooking one side.
8. Trust the Toothpick Test
When your cake or muffins are nearing the end of their baking time, insert a toothpick into the center. If it comes out clean or with a few moist crumbs clinging to it, your treat is done!
9. Cool Properly
Once baked, allow your treats to cool in the pan for a few minutes before transferring them to wire racks. This prevents sogginess and helps maintain texture.
